Local Tree Work in Mount Maunganui

Mount Maunganui falls within the Tauranga City Council jurisdiction, occupying a unique tombolo — a narrow neck of compacted dune sand — that connects the iconic 232-metre Mauao lava dome to the mainland between the Pacific Ocean and Tauranga Harbour. Properties throughout this densely developed coastal suburb sit on sandy, low-lying terrain, and mature trees develop root systems adapted to these free-draining, nutrient-limited substrates. The Tauranga City Plan maintains a Notable Tree Register and Significant Groups of Trees Register, meaning individually scheduled specimens require resource consent before removal. Pohutukawa are the defining native species here — approximately 580 individuals have been mapped on Mauao alone, with the oldest specimen at the Pitau Road reserve estimated at 400 to 500 years of age. Mauao itself is owned by the Ngāi Te Rangi, Ngāti Ranginui, and Ngāti Pūkenga iwi and jointly managed with council through the Mauao Trust, adding cultural heritage considerations to any vegetation work near the mountain's base. Do I need a permit to remove a tree in Mount Maunganui?

Sometimes. If the tree is listed as notable or scheduled under your council's district plan, you need resource consent before touching it. You can check your council's GIS mapping tool online using your property address. For this area, contact Tauranga City Council on 07 577 7000. Getting it wrong can mean fines and a requirement to replace the tree at your cost.

How long does tree removal take in Mount Maunganui?

A standard residential tree removal in Mount Maunganui usually takes between two and six hours depending on size and access. Larger jobs — multiple trees, tight access, or significant rigging required — can take a full day. We'll give you a realistic timeframe when we do the site visit.
